What are Quarterly Tax Payments?
Quarterly tax payments are payments made to the IRS and state tax authorities four times a year. These payments are also known as estimated tax payments and are made by individuals and businesses who do not have taxes withheld from their income. This includes freelancers, self-employed individuals, and small business owners.
When are Quarterly Tax Payments Due?
The due dates for quarterly tax payments in 2022 are:
- April 15, 2022
- June 15, 2022
- September 15, 2022
- January 15, 2023
It's important to note that these due dates may change if they fall on a weekend or holiday.
How to Calculate Quarterly Tax Payments?
Calculating quarterly tax payments can be a bit tricky, as it involves estimating your income and expenses for the year. The IRS provides a worksheet to help you calculate your estimated tax payments, which can be found on their website.
It's important to keep accurate records of your income and expenses throughout the year to ensure that you are making accurate quarterly tax payments.
What Happens if You Don't Make Quarterly Tax Payments?
If you don't make quarterly tax payments, you may be subject to penalties and interest charges. The IRS may also require you to pay back any taxes owed in one lump sum, which can be difficult for some individuals and businesses to manage.
How to Make Quarterly Tax Payments?
There are several ways to make quarterly tax payments, including:
- Online through the IRS website
- By mail using Form 1040-ES
- By phone using the Electronic Federal Tax Payment System (EFTPS)
It's important to make sure that your quarterly tax payments are submitted on time and with the correct information to avoid any penalties or interest charges.
